Preparing the Soil for Optimal Plant Health

Soil preparation is an important step in having healthy plants. Preparing the soil prior to planting ensures that your plants have access to all the nutrients they need for growth. It also helps to reduce soil compaction, which can cause poor drainage and impede root growth. In this article, we’ll discuss some of the best methods for preparing the soil for optimal plant health.

The first step in preparing soil is to determine its pH level. This will help you decide which amendments need to be added to ensure optimal nutrient availability and root growth. Most plants prefer soils with a pH between 6 and 7, but some plants may have specific needs. If your soil’s pH is too high or too low, you can adjust it by adding limestone or sulfur respectively.

Once you’ve determined your soil’s pH level, you should add organic matter such as compost or manure to improve aeration and drainage. This will also help retain moisture in the soil and provide vital nutrients for your plants. If possible, it’s best to use organic matter that has been aged or composted for at least six months.

Cultivating the soil is another important step in preparing it for planting. This involves loosening the top few inches of dirt so that roots can penetrate more easily. You can do this by using a shovel or tiller to break up any clumps of dirt and incorporate organic matter into the top layer of soil.

Finally, it’s important to test your soil’s nutrient levels before planting anything in it. This will help you identify any deficiencies that need to be addressed prior to planting so that your plants are getting all the nutrients they need for healthy growth.

By following these steps, you can ensure that your soil is properly prepared for optimal plant health!

Mulching the Strawberry Beds

Mulching the strawberry beds is an important step in ensuring healthy, productive plants. Mulch helps to control weeds, conserve moisture, moderate soil temperature and improve fruit quality. It also helps to reduce disease incidence. Straw is the most commonly used mulch material for strawberries, as it has a number of advantages over other materials. It helps to keep fruit clean and free from soil-borne diseases, and it insulates the strawberry crowns against temperature extremes. Additionally, straw breaks down slowly and does not need to be replaced during the season as often as some other mulches.

When selecting straw for mulching strawberry beds, be sure to choose clean straw that is free from weed seeds or insects. The straw should be applied around established plants after they have set fruit buds in late winter or early spring. It should be spread evenly over the entire bed at a depth of 3-5 inches (7.5-12 cm). If possible, try to avoid piling it too thickly around the crowns of individual plants as this can trap excess moisture and cause disease problems. When applying straw mulch around young plants in early spring, make sure not to cover up any emerging shoots or leaves as this can prevent them from getting enough sunlight for proper growth.

Once applied, straw mulch should be kept moist throughout the growing season to help it break down slowly and provide consistent benefits to your strawberry crop. Be sure to water regularly and thoroughly so that all of the plant roots are able to access adequate moisture for optimal growth and fruiting. When harvesting crops, take care not to disturb the mulch layers too much; if necessary, replace any disturbed areas with fresh material.

Mulching strawberry beds is a great way to keep your crop healthy throughout its growing season. Not only does it help control weeds and conserve moisture but it also moderates soil temperature and improves fruit quality by keeping them clean from soil-borne diseases. With careful selection of clean straw material and correct application techniques you can ensure that your strawberry crop will perform its best this year!

Installing Frost Cloths and Covers

Frost cloths and covers provide excellent protection for plants from frost, wind, and hail. Installing them correctly is important for protecting your plants from the elements. Before installing a frost cloth or cover, you should make sure to measure your plants’ dimensions accurately, as this will help ensure the right size of cloth or cover is chosen. Additionally, it’s important to choose a fabric that is breathable and permeable to prevent condensation build-up. Once you have chosen the correct size of frost cloth or cover, you can install it over your plants.

The installation process involves anchoring the frost cloth or cover securely in place with stakes, ropes, or ties. If you’re using stakes, make sure they are firmly driven into the ground at least 6 inches deep to ensure stability in windy conditions. You can also use ropes or ties to secure the frost cloth or cover at each corner and in the middle if needed. Additionally, you should keep edges of the covering tucked under soil or mulch to reduce heat loss and keep air circulation going underneath.

Finally, once you have installed your frost cloth or cover properly, check periodically that it is still securely in place and that any anchors used are still firmly attached to the ground. This will help ensure that your plants stay protected from any extreme weather conditions that may arise.
